Transaction 44472096c2c82125b43da41cb86f11fd153bac4e2f8ca947854728ceffdf4b60
1 Input
1 Output
-
44472096c2c82125b43da41cb86f11fd153bac4e2f8ca947854728ceffdf4b60:0
- value
- 50843829
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f051350ade2cb40f5ba75e12c2cdc0bbb8bda65
- address
- bc1qruz3x59dut95pad6whsjctxupwachkn9yrkezl